Am 2007-01-25 11:13 +0100 schrieb Philipp Matthias Hahn:

> Yes, see below. Three more questions:
> 1. Since the "Aureon7.1", "Prodigy7.1" and my "Prodigy7.1HiFi"; as well
> as the "Prodigy7.1LT" and the "Prodigy7.1XT" respectively seem so share
> the same EEPROM-Date, wouldn't it be better to re-use/share those
> eeprom-data instead of declaring them 3 respectively 2 times?

In my opinion Prodigy7.1HiFi eeprom_ data has to be slightly
different, I need to put 

[ICE_EEP2_SYSCONF] = 0x4b

instead of

[ICE_EEP2_SYSCONF] = 0x0b

Otherwise I got speeded up sound playback.
See note (0014172) in this thread by me.

What I am currently fiddling about is the CS8415A Chip:

ALSA /XXX/alsa-kernel/pci/ice1712/aureon.c:1921: No CS8415
chip. Skipping CS8415 controls.

In the note (0014176) I am trying to search it at the i2c address it
should appear at. Still I did not found it :-)
